Camping Municipal, Civray-de-Touraine

Camping Municipal, Civray-de-Touraine provides an ideal base for visits to Château de Chenonceaux, Château de Amboise, Loches, Montrésor, Château de Chambord and Tours.

Description 

Bléré with numerous small shops and several supermarkets is only a couple of miles west of the campsite and is well worth a visit.

Many historical places of interest are within a 25 mile (40 km) radius of Civray-de-Touraine.

Notes 

After travelling most of the night and with just a few hours sleep, we arrived in Tours rather tired and desperate to find a pleasant campsite and showers.

Thanks to the 'satnav' and an altered road junction we were treated to a 'magical mystery tour' of Tours, before finally finding a road which took us out of the city in an easterly direction.

After a few more miles we decided to stop at the first village that proclaimed a campsite. Thus we made our first camp on the municipal campsite at Civray-de-Touraine.
